I am having problems getting images to show for each respected category, I have uploaded the images fine in the category folder and they show up when I choose them within the forum setting for each category, but they are not showing up on the forum once done. I even scaled the images to 32x32 like the original category image sizes. What seems to be the problem? Would love some help.

The code to render the category images is not present in v1.9.3

This post will show you how to add the needed code to have the

images show up.HTH
